Meryn Cooper has inherited a kingdom teetering on the edge of collapse. As the newly crowned queen of Nocturna, she faces a fractured realm where nobles, commoners, and the magical Bonded are locked in a volatile power struggle. With her direwolf, Anassa, by her side, Meryn must navigate a treacherous political landscape where every alliance is a potential betrayal and her younger sister’s safety remains in constant jeopardy.
Amidst this rising chaos, Meryn finds her most vital ally in Stark Therion, the formidable Alpha who once stood as her sworn enemy. Their relationship remains a volatile friction of past loathing and newfound, intoxicating loyalty. As Stark guides her toward a devastating level of power, the lines between duty and desire blur.
With dark shadows invading her dreams and enemies closing in from every corner of the splintered kingdom, Meryn is forced to choose between the survival of her throne and the preservation of her heart. In a world where blood is the currency of survival, Meryn must decide if the price of vengeance is worth the ruin it promises to leave in its wake.
